Home Depot
25 mile radius of Pensacola, FL
8/8/2025
Pensacola, FL, US
Pensacola, FL, US
Pensacola, FL, US
Pensacola, FL, US
8/1/2025
Pensacola, FL, US
Pensacola, FL, US
Pensacola, FL, US
Pace, FL, US
Pensacola, FL, US
Pace, FL, US